Classic Peach Cobbler

A warm, comforting dessert featuring sweet, tender peaches topped with a golden, buttery batter.
Prep Time 10 minutes
Cook Time 45 minutes
Total Time 55 minutes
Servings: 4 servings
Course: Dessert
Cuisine: American
Calories: 320

Ingredients
  

Filling and Batter
  • 4 cups sliced fresh peaches approx 800g
  • 1 cup granulated sugar approx 200g
  • 1 cup all-purpose flour approx 125g
  • 1 cup milk approx 240ml
  • 1/2 cup unsalted butter melted, approx 115g
  • 1 tbsp baking powder approx 15g
  • 1 tsp ground cinnamon approx 5g

Equipment

  • Baking dish
  • Mixing bowl
  • Whisk

Method
 

Preparation
  1. Preheat your oven to 350F (175C).
  2. Place the sliced peaches into a baking dish.
  3. Whisk together the flour, sugar, baking powder, and milk in a bowl until the mixture is smooth.
  4. Pour the batter evenly over the peaches, then drizzle the melted butter over the top.
  5. Sprinkle the ground cinnamon over the entire dish.
  6. Bake for 45 minutes until the topping is golden brown and the filling is bubbly.

Notes

Serve warm, ideally with a scoop of vanilla ice cream.
